    The M109s don't have a six-speed gearbox because there is enough torque in the 109 that they can use a wider spread between the gears, a "wide ratio gearbox". There would really be no benefit except maybe for an extreme overdrive but that may cause other stress-related problems in the drive train.
    The big old Kawasaki 2000cc, 125 cubic inch, had a five-speed also. Torque monster! Ride a torquey five-speed bike for a while, I'll bet you may not want to go back to a six-speed.
